Q: Is 835,710 a Composite Number?

 A: Yes, 835,710 is a composite number.

Why is 835,710 a composite number?

A composite number is a number that can be divided evenly by more numbers than 1 and itself. It is the opposite of a prime number.

The number 835,710 can be evenly divided by 1 2 3 5 6 10 15 30 89 178 267 313 445 534 626 890 939 1,335 1,565 1,878 2,670 3,130 4,695 9,390 27,857 55,714 83,571 139,285 167,142 278,570 417,855 and 835,710, with no remainder.

Since 835,710 cannot be divided by just 1 and 835,710, it is a composite number.
